On Thu, Apr 27, 2017 at 10:55:47AM -0600, Ian Lepore wrote:
> On Thu, 2017-04-27 at 16:46 +0000, Sergey A. Osokin wrote:
> > On Thu, Apr 27, 2017 at 08:24:55AM +0200, Mathieu Arnold wrote:
> > > 
> > > Le 26/04/2017 ?? 18:53, Sergey A. Osokin a ??crit :
> > > > 
> > > > On Wed, Apr 26, 2017 at 06:18:44PM +0200, Mathieu Arnold wrote:
> > > > > 
> > > > > Le 26/04/2017 ?? 01:18, Sergey A. Osokin a ??crit :
> > > > > > 
> > > > > > Author: osa
> > > > > > Date: Tue Apr 25 23:18:09 2017
> > > > > > New Revision: 439421
> > > > > > URL: https://svnweb.freebsd.org/changeset/ports/439421
> > > > > > 
> > > > > > Log:
> > > > > > š Upgrade from 1.10.3 to 1.12.0.
> > > > > > šš
> > > > > > š ChangeLog:	http://nginx.org/en/CHANGES-1.12
> > > > > > šš
> > > > > > š Remove IPV6 knob, IPv6 now compiled-in automatically if
> > > > > > support is found.
> > > > > This still feels like a very bad idea.
> > > > Could you please explain what exactly is very bad here?
> > > We had that talk like a week or two ago. It means that if the
> > > package
> > > builder support IPv6 it will not work on a box without it, and if
> > > the
> > > package builder does not support IPv6, a box with IPv6 will not be
> > > able
> > > to use nginx with IPv6.
> > Then you can go ahead and enable IPv6 on the package builder like you
> > did the
> > same for the third-party moz_zip module.
> > 
> > INET6 in FreeBSD's GENERIC kernel for years, I see no reason why
> > shouldn't use it.
> 
> Why do you continue to argue with multiple people who've expressed a
> real-world need for this utterly trivial request to leave the IPV6 knob
> in place?

A workaround for a real-world has been provided.
There is no way to keep IPV6 knob's behaviour as is cause the configuration
option has been removed.
 
> In the real world I have builder machines which DO have IPv6 enabled,
> which must be able to create packages that run on machines that do NOT
> have IPv6 enabled.

Again.  It's possible to use a package built on a box with enabled IPv6
support on a box with IPv6 support disabled.
